Design Week: This week, we speak with Yuliya Ratnikova, design director at Ascend Studio, about the power of noticing the overlooked. Yuliya Ratnikova is design director at Ascend Studio in Farringdon, London. The studio, which is approaching its 20th birthday, creates strategic brands across the tech, real estate, lifestyle and culture, corporate and experiential sectors.
